Evaluation and assessment of Uruguayan Forest Certification scheme against the requirements of the PEFC Council Executive Summary Recommendation to PEFC Council Board of Directors The Uruguayan Forest Certification Scheme (UFCS), as presented by PEFC Uruguay on 8 January 2010, together with supporting documentation (refer to 2.3 of this Report), does not meet the requirements of the Programme for the Endorsement of Forest Certification (PEFC) Scheme. The UFCS has several incidences of non-conformity, further detailed in parts 1(b), 1(c), 2(b), 5(c) and 5(d) of Summary of Findings. The consultants consider that the identified non-conformities, with exception of 1(b), do not hamper creditable and reliable UFCS implementation consistent with PEFCC requirements. The consultants base this conclusion on detailed commentary included in the body of the following report. The consultants recommend that PEFCC consider the option of conditional endorsement of the UFCS, subject to PEFCC approval of the organisational and individual participation arrangements implemented by Instituto Uruguayo De Normas Técnicas (UNIT) to develop and approve forest management standards (UNIT 1151: 2009 and UNIT 1152: 2009). Summary of Findings The justification for endorsement is based on the following findings: 1. For standard setting processes – initiated by the Uruguayan Society of Forestry Producers and managed by Instituto Uruguayo de Normas Técnicas (UNIT) - against PEFCC requirements: a. Independence processes conform with PEFCC requirements (refer to Section 3.1.1); b. Participatory processes do not conform to PEFCC requirements. Documentation presented by PEFC Uruguay and the Instituto Uruguayo De Normas Técnicas (UNIT) does not provide evidence that environmental non-government organisations were formally invited to participate in development and approval of forest management standards (as detailed in Section 3.1.2 and 3.5 of Report); c. Public consultation processes do not conform to PEFCC requirements. The public consultation processes implemented by UNIT for final draft of forest management standards (as detailed in Sections 3.1.2 and 3.5 of Report) was less than 60 days specified in PEFCC requirements; d. Pilot testing practices conform with PEFCC requirements (refer Section 3.3); e. Review of standard documentation conforms to PEFCC requirements (refer to Section 3.4). 2. For implementation of the UFCS against PEFCC requirements: a. General requirements of the UFCS in areas such as types of forests, management systems, auditing verification, property and land tenure, and customary and traditional rights conform with requirements of PEFCC (refer to Sections 4.1.1 and 4.1.2); b. Documented process for the UFCS do not conform with PEFCC requirements for making a summary of forest management plan publicly available (as detailed in Section 4.1.2 of Report); c. Required compliance with laws and regulations conform to PEFCC requirements (refer to Section 4.1.3); d. Level of implementation for individual and group forest certification processes for the UFCS conform with PEFCC requirements (refer to Section 4.2); e. Appeals, complaints and dispute procedures documented for the UFCS conform to PEFCC requirements (refer to 4.3). 3. The forest management standards (UNIT 1151: 2009 and UNIT 1152: 2009) conform to PEFCC requirements for compliance with Pan European Operational Level Guidelines for Sustainable Forest Management (PEOLG) (refer to Section 5). www.itsglobal.net Page 7
